Consumer Description
WHILE DRIVING AT NIGHT DRIVER NOTICED THAT THE TAIL LIGHTS, CRUISE CONTROL, AND BRAKE LIGHTS WERE INOPERATIVE. THIS CAUSED POOR VISIBILITY TO THE DRIVER. V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O A GARAGE FOR INSPECTION, BUT MECHANIC COULD NOT DUPLICATE THE PROBLEM. *AK
